The invention relates to a motor vehicle with a novel transverse plate spring suspension, comprising: a driving assistance system for acquiring one or more of vehicle driving data, environmental dataand load data through a plurality of sensors; and a suspension system, which includes a plate spring and at least two first adjusting assemblies arranged on the plate spring in a sleeving mode. The suspension system is characterized in that the suspension system further comprises at least one second adjusting assembly and a suspension regulation and control module; an adjustable interval is correspondingly formed between the at least one first adjusting assembly and the at least one second adjusting assembly; wherein the suspension regulation and control module is configured to realize mode conversion among at least three rigidity regulation modes determined by analyzing based on vehicle driving data, environment data and load data in combination with a pre-stored mode conversion judgmentcondition in a double-interval independent regulation and/or coupling regulation mode so as to adapt to different driving conditions.
